This study investigates the optimal insurance when moral hazard exists in loss reduction. We identify that full insurance is optimal up to a limit and partial insurance is optimal above that limit. For a prudent individual, the indemnity schedule is convex, linear, or concave in the loss in which partial insurance is optimal, depending on the shapes of the utility and loss distribution. The optimal insurance may contain a deductible for large losses only when the indemnity schedule is convex. It may also include a fixed reimbursement when the schedule is convex or concave. When the loss distribution belongs to the linear exponential family, the indemnity schedule is concave under IARA and CARA, whereas it can be concave or convex under DARA.
